Harley-Davidson Inc. (ISIN US4128221086) remains anchored in heavyweight motorcycles, with the company built around touring, cruiser and related products that define its core brand. The stock trades on the New York Stock Exchange under HOG, keeping the name tied to a long-established US consumer discretionary story.

Core business

Harley-Davidson's model is still straightforward: sell premium motorcycles, parts, accessories and financial services to riders who value brand identity as much as metal and horsepower. That mix gives investors a business tied to discretionary spending, financing demand and the health of the high-end motorcycle market.

The company also has a clear US-market anchor through its New York listing and its investor relations site at Harley-Davidson investor relations, which frames the stock around filings, earnings updates and corporate disclosures rather than a single headline event.

What matters now

For investors, the key interpretive point is that Harley-Davidson is a brand-led industrial company, so margin pressure or pricing power often matters more than unit growth alone. That makes the stock especially sensitive to how well the company protects premium positioning in a cyclical consumer market.

Against peers in discretionary manufacturing, Harley-Davidson carries a more distinctive identity because the brand itself is a core asset and a core risk. A stronger mix of touring and premium bikes can support profitability, while weaker demand can show up quickly in sentiment.

Representative product

One representative product is the Harley-Davidson touring motorcycle line, which captures the company's focus on long-distance riding, larger engines and higher-priced trim levels. That category helps explain why the brand has remained relevant to enthusiasts even as the broader motorcycle market changes.
